The Rise of Bitcoin Brokers: Understanding the Basics

The concept of Bitcoin brokers emerged with the growing interest in Bitcoin as an alternative form of investment. A Bitcoin broker is simply an intermediary who connects buyers and sellers and facilitates Bitcoin trading. For users who are new to Bitcoin, these brokers provide a user-friendly interface that simplifies the buying and selling process. Experienced users rely on the expertise of these brokers to make quick trades and execute complex orders.

With the growing adoption of Bitcoin, the number of Bitcoin brokerage services has surged. Each of these brokers offers different features, including different fee structures, trading platforms, regulatory compliance, and customer support. This is where the need for a comprehensive guide on Bitcoin brokers arises – to help users navigate the labyrinth of options and make the best possible choice.

Security

Security should be a top priority when choosing a Bitcoin broker. Look for brokers that offer robust security measures, including two-factor authentication, SSL encryption, and cold storage for user funds.

Regulatory Compliance

Regulatory compliance is crucial for ensuring that your Bitcoin trades are legitimate and safe. Check if the broker is registered with relevant regulatory bodies and adheres to anti-money laundering (AML) and know-your-customer (KYC) laws.

Trading Platform

Customer Support

Customer support is essential when dealing with any financial service. Ensure that the broker provides reliable and responsive customer support through various channels, including live chat, email, and phone support.

Trading Fees

Trading fees can vary significantly among Bitcoin brokers. Some brokers charge fixed fees while others charge a percentage of the trade value. Ensure that you understand the fee structure to avoid any unexpected costs.

Payment Options

Check if the broker offers a wide range of payment options, such as credit cards, bank transfers, and digital wallets. More payment options provide more flexibility and convenience for users.

User Interface

A user-friendly interface can make all the difference in your trading experience. Look for a broker that provides a simple and intuitive interface that makes trading easy for beginners and experts alike.

Frequently Asked Questions about Bitcoin Brokers

1. What is a Bitcoin broker?

A Bitcoin broker is an intermediary that connects buyers and sellers and facilitates Bitcoin trading.

2. Are Bitcoin brokers regulated?

Some Bitcoin brokers are regulated by relevant regulatory bodies, while others are not.

3. How do Bitcoin brokers differ from Bitcoin exchanges?

Bitcoin brokers provide a user-friendly platform that simplifies the buying and selling process, while exchanges allow users to buy and sell Bitcoin directly with other users.

4. How do Bitcoin brokers make money?

Bitcoin brokers make money by charging trading fees or taking a percentage of the trade value.

5. Do Bitcoin brokers provide wallet services?

Some Bitcoin brokers provide wallet services, while others require users to have their own wallets.
